Full Job Description
Cloud Developer - GNOS Platform (Glenview, IL)

The GNOS Cloud Developer is part of GN's R&D organization and designs, builds, and operates cloud-native services for the GNOS platform - a core foundation for our fitting software and patient-facing solutions in the US and globally.

You will sit inside R&D's product development teams, working closely with product management, architects, and application teams to create secure, scalable cloud services that enable hearing care professionals, partners, and end users to configure, fit, and manage GN hearing solutions.

You will collaborate with colleagues across R&D sites in the US, Denmark, Poland, and India to ensure GNOS services are robust, observable, and easy for downstream applications (fitting tools, mobile apps, portals) to consume.

GN Store Nord A/S has entered into a definitive agreement for the sale of GN's Hearing business to Amplifon S.p.A. to create a global leader in audiology. For GN Group, this creates an opportunity to expand our position in the large audio and video peripherals markets. Read more about the announcement here.

About SteelSeries

SteelSeries is a leading manufacturer of gaming peripherals, including mice, keyboards, and headsets. The company offers a wide range of products that are designed to enhance the gaming experience, with features such as high precision sensors, customizable lighting, and immersive audio. SteelSeries is committed to providing high-quality products and exceptional customer service, and has been recognized for its excellence by numerous industry organizations. The company was founded in 2001 and is headquartered in Glenview, Illinois.
